- [ ] **Key ceremony step 7 — Profile-store shard split (Opaline)**

Support: this step covers re-keying during the user-profile store split from 4 to 16 shards. Confirm both custodians are present. Verify shard map checksum matches the printed ceremony sheet. Freeze profile writes; reads stay up. Rotate the shard encryption keys one ring at a time, oldest first. Do not proceed if any shard reports lag over 60s. After rotation, the escrow terminal will prompt for the ceremony recovery passphrase, which is recorded just below.

vault phrase of tajeg-tageg = pelix-druix-holius-briael-zorwyn-frawyn-fraox-norok-drueth-aldiel

Onboarding: GateTally turnstile counter (support team)

GateTally aggregates turnstile counts from the Corvanne Arena gates and posts totals to the ops dashboard every 30 seconds. Most support tickets are stale counts — restart the collector first. Config lives in one env file on the collector host: gate IDs, poll rate, dashboard URL. If counts post but auth errors appear in logs, check the ingest credential, which is set on the next line.

vault entry, bagep-yahip: VAULT_KEY8=d2a227e5

## Reviewing changes to the Quillgate deduplicator

When reviewing patches to the alert dedup logic, verify that the fingerprint function remains stable across restarts and that suppression windows never exceed fifteen minutes. Run the replay harness against last week's alert corpus before approving. Any change to grouping keys requires sign-off from the Palewick reliability crew. The replay harness documentation is maintained here.

runbook for badug-kadup: https://confluence.zemvarlabs.internal/projects/browse/display/projects/bd1b

## Escalation: Encoding Detection Failures

When the Glasswing upload service misclassifies a text file's encoding, first capture the original byte stream before any transcoding step, since the sniffer's confidence scores are only logged pre-normalization. Reproduce with the detector in verbose mode and attach the score table. If confidence falls below 0.6 on two consecutive runs, treat it as a detector defect rather than user error, and escalate with the full evidence bundle.

pager mailbox: fenael_wenael@norvalabs.corp